Lee E Debell

0.0
(0 Reviews)
4598 SW Calloway St, 34953 Port Saint Lucie

Map

4598 SW Calloway St, 34953 Port Saint Lucie

Reviews

Unverified Reviews
0.0
(0 Reviews)